如果将关键字PRIMARYKEY添加到列定义中,则该表的主键由该单列组成。或者,如果将PRIMARYKEY子句指定为表约束,则该表的主键由作为PRIMARYKEY子句的一部分指定的列的列表组成。
2.0Quirks rowid表(如果有的话)的PRIMARYKEY通常不是表的真正主键,因为它不是底层B树存储引擎使用的唯一键。此规则的例外是rowid表声明了INTEGERPRIMARYKEY。
入门 安装 用法 使用查询使用ActiveRecord 其他主题 使用elasticsearchDebugPanel具有主键不属于属性的记录的关系定义从不同的索引/类型中获取记录
<id>标签将类中独一无二的ID属性与数据库表中的主键关联起来。id元素中的name属性引用类的性质,column属性引用数据库表的列。
MongoDB采用ObjectId,而不是其他比较常规的做法(比如自动增加的主键)的主要原因,因为在多个服务器上同步自动增加主键值既费力还费时。
DELETE更改表示一个由其主键值标识的行,以从数据库表中删除。DELETE更改的有效内容由已删除行的所有字段的值组成。一个UPDATE。
如果两行具有相同的主键,则更改集中的更改将被视为应用于同一行,作为更改组中已存在的更改。 对尚未出现在更改组中的行的更改将被简单地复制到其中。
此属性映射到数据库表的主键列。所有将被持久化的属性都应该声明为private,并具有由JavaBean风格定义的getXXX和setXXX方法。
这通常是(但不总是)父表的主键。父键必须是父表中的一个或多个命名列,而不是rowid。 该子键是列或一组由外键约束的约束和保持references子句中的子表列。
@Id和@GeneratedValue注释 每一个实体bean都有一个主键,你在类中可以用@Id来进行注释。主键可以是一个字段或者是多个字段的组合,这取决于你的表的结构。

扫码关注腾讯云开发者
领取腾讯云代金券
Copyright © 2013 - 2026 Tencent Cloud. All Rights Reserved. 腾讯云 版权所有
深圳市腾讯计算机系统有限公司 ICP备案/许可证号:粤B2-20090059
粤公网安备44030502008569号
腾讯云计算(北京)有限责任公司 京ICP证150476号 | 京ICP备11018762号
